In dit nummer

Providing high-quality healthcare in this day and age requires the latest health technology. In this issue, we highlight the newest digitisation initiatives in Asia’s healthcare sector, as well as its progress towards achieving net-zero goals.
Even as the global pandemic persists, Asia’s healthcare pivots back to non-communicable disease, which remains its ‘blind spot’. SingHealth Duke-NUS launches a new institute that opens doors for maternal-child care research (page 14), whilst OneOnco introduces a digital-based solution for patients seeking to kickstart a cancer support system for $1 (page 18). In this issue, we feature Pondok Indah Group Hospital, the only hospital group in Indonesia to achieve the highest level of HIMSS EMRAM validation. See the full story on page 16.
We sat down with Adeeba Kamarulzaman, President of the International AIDS Society, to discuss their latest campaign that promotes stigma-free HIV care in Asia. See the full story on page 24. We also talked with Dr. Khaw Hoon Hoon, one of the founders of Malaysia’s OasisEye Specialists, on their clinic’s utilisation of AI machines in remote areas where doctors are scarce. See the full interview on page 28.

Healthcare Asia Magazine Description:

Healthcare Asia is a half- yearly magazine that serves Asia's hospital owners, investors, administrators and policy makers. It is published by Charlton Media Group and is available in print and digital formats.

Healthcare Asia provides in-depth coverage of the latest news, trends, and developments in the Asian healthcare industry. The magazine features articles on a wide range of topics, including:

* Hospital management: Healthcare Asia covers all aspects of hospital management, from strategic planning to financial management to clinical operations.

* Healthcare policy: Healthcare Asia discusses the latest healthcare policies and regulations in Asia, and their impact on the healthcare industry.

* Healthcare technology: Healthcare Asia covers the latest healthcare technologies and innovations, and how they are being used to improve healthcare delivery in Asia.

* Healthcare finance: Healthcare Asia covers the latest trends in healthcare finance, including investment opportunities and mergers and acquisitions.

The magazine also features interviews with key decision-makers in the Asian healthcare industry, such as CEOs of hospitals and healthcare companies, government officials, and healthcare experts.
